'Sheigra Gulley'
Cathy Hollingdale

Located in the far NW of scotland, Kinlochbervie offers clear Atlantic water, rich marine life and dramatic scenery both above and below the water. We discovered this particular site around 4 years ago, I’ve since dived it around 40 times. On this dive I was with one of my regular buddies so we headed off to explore the site a little further. We’d started at the main surge gulley, located the entrance to this one and headed along, its around 100m long and is quite stunning with some very interesting topography. Its around 8/10m deep at this point as it narrows and frames by buddy quite well with the beautiful red sea squirts, elephant and white lattice sponges.

Judge's comment: In the early days of the British Society of Underwater Photographers, one of the stated goals of the society was to photograph the full length of a diver in British conditions. This image would have blown their minds. A stunning shot and amazing conditions too.
Alex Mustard
